Ritual

Webster's Dictionary

(1):

(n.) Hence, the code of ceremonies observed by an organization; as, the ritual of the freemasons.

(2):

(a.) Of or pertaining to rites or ritual; as, ritual service or sacrifices; the ritual law.

(3):

(n.) A prescribed form of performing divine service in a particular church or communion; as, the Jewish ritual.

(4):

(n.) A book containing the rites to be observed.
